The 26th Arab International Cement and Building Materials Conference and Exhibition (AICCE26) kicked off in Cairo on Monday with the participation of 750 exhibitioners in 142 pavilions.

The AICCE26 is organized in coordination with the Council of Arab Economic Unity and the Council of Arab Ministers for Housing and Reconstruction between 15 and 17 January.

The cement sector is one of Egypt’s key industrial sectors, as it supplies basic needs for the infrastructure and urban projects in the country, Minister of Trade and Industry Ahmed Samir said in a statement.

Samir noted that Egypt is among the 10 biggest cement producers in the world with an annual output of 92 million tons.

Meanwhile, Nayef bin Sultan, head of the Arab Union for Cement and Building Materials, stated that the cement sector in Arab countries has seen major development in recent years, fulfilling local needs and creating a surplus for export.
